Kinds Of Car Keys
Before delving into the programming aspect, it is important to understand the different types of car keys presently in use. go to this website will help distinguish the programming approaches required for each type.
- Conventional Keys: These are one of the most fundamental kind of car keys. They have no electronic components and can normally be cut by a locksmith with the appropriate key code.
- Transponder Keys: These keys include a chip that communicates with the car's ignition system. If the chip is not recognized, the car won't begin. Programming involves synchronizing the chip with the car's Computer Control Unit (CCU).
- Remote Key Fobs: These keys combine conventional key functions with remote locking and opening capabilities. They normally have built-in transponders, needing comparable programming as transponder keys.
- Smart Keys: Also referred to as keyless entry systems, clever keys don't require physical insertion into the ignition. They use a wireless system to unlock and start the vehicle when the key is in close proximity.
- Keyless Ignition Keys: These keys work like smart keys however particularly concentrate on starting the vehicle without standard ignition approaches.
The complexity of programming these keys differs, often making it challenging for car owners to manage the process independently.
The Key Programming Process
Programming a car type in Milton Keynes usually includes the following actions:
Step 1: Obtain the Correct Key
To program a brand-new key, you first need to make sure that you have the right key type for your vehicle. Keys can differ greatly in between makers and designs, and the incorrect key will not program to your car.
Step 2: Access the Vehicle's Onboard Diagnostics (OBD) Port
A lot of contemporary cars have an OBD-II port, generally situated under the control panel. This port allows the key programming tool to access the vehicle's computer system to program new keys.
Step 3: Use a Key Programmer Tool
Expert locksmiths or car dealerships make use of specialized key programming tools. These devices connect to your car's OBD-II port and permit users to input commands to add brand-new keys.
Step 4: Follow the Programming Instructions
The key programming tool will normally offer on-screen directions tailored to the make and model of the vehicle. Here's a basic summary that might be involved in the programming process:
- Turn the ignition to the ON position.
- Link the key developer to the OBD-II port.
- Select the vehicle design on the developer.
- Follow the prompts to program a new key.
- Check the recently configured key to make sure performance.
Step 5: Verify the New Key
After programming, test the new key to make sure that it can start the vehicle and carry out remote locking/unlocking functions (if relevant).
Typical Issues Encountered
Although programming car keys may seem simple, various problems can arise, consisting of:
- Incorrect Key Type: Using the incorrect key can result in failure in programming.
- Faulty Key Fob: Sometimes, the key fob itself may be defective.
- Battery Issues: Low battery in the key fob can avoid it from interacting with the vehicle.
- Software application Issues: Occasionally, concerns within the vehicle's software application may prevent effective programming.
